4 votes

Safari ne veut se connecter à localhost que via HTTPS

Je développe beaucoup en local et j'ai récemment remarqué que je ne pouvais pas me connecter à des services non HTPS fonctionnant sur localhost. Si les services fournissent HTTPS, je peux me connecter, mais chaque fois que j'essaie quelque chose comme " http://devsite:8000 "Safari essaie toujours d'accéder à " https://devsite.local:8000 ".

En utilisant Chrome, je peux accéder correctement au site.

Peut-être le problème est-il le HSTS ?

J'utilise Safari 10.1 sur MacOS Sierra.

2voto

Husman Points 586

En fait, on dirait que c'était le HSTS.

J'ai suivi les instructions affichées aquí :

  1. Fermer le safari.
  2. Supprimez le fichier ~/Library/Cookies/HSTS.plist.
  3. Rouvrez Safari.

Et maintenant les sites localhost fonctionnent correctement.

LesApples.com

L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.

Powered by:

X